UPVC Door Panel Fitting: A Comprehensive Guide
When it comes to enhancing the security and looks of a home, doors play a vital function. Amongst numerous door products, UPVC (Unplasticized Polyvinyl Chloride) doors have gotten enormous popularity due to their resilience, energy efficiency, and low maintenance requirements. This short article aims to provide an in-depth guide on UPVC door panel fitting, covering everything from tools required to installation actions and FAQs.
What is UPVC and Why Choose it?
UPVC is a type of plastic that is extensively utilized in structure and building and construction, particularly in door and window frames. It uses numerous benefits that make it an appealing choice for house owners.
Benefits of UPVC Doors
- Sturdiness: UPVC doors are resistant to weathering, rust, and fading. Unlike wood doors, they do not warp or require painting.
- Low Maintenance: UPVC requires minimal maintenance— typically just a wipe down with soapy water.
- Energy Efficiency: UPVC doors are understood for their insulation properties, helping to maintain a comfy home temperature level and decrease energy expenses.
- Security: Many UPVC doors include multi-point locking systems, boosting home security.
Provided these benefits, it's no surprise that numerous homeowners select UPVC doors. However, appropriate fitting is important to gain these benefits fully.
Tools and Materials Needed for Fitting UPVC Door Panels
Before starting the installation process, gather the needed tools and materials:
Tools Required
- Drill: A power drill for making holes in the frame.
- Screwdriver: For attaching screws firmly.
- Level: To guarantee the door is correctly aligned.
- Determining Tape: For precise measurements.
- Hacksaw or Panel Cutter: To cut the UPVC panel if needed.
- Sealant Gun: For using silicone sealant.
- Clamps: To hold the panel in place momentarily.
Materials Required
- UPVC Door Panel: Choose a panel that fits your door frame.
- Screws and Fixings: Ensure they are ideal for use with UPVC.
- Silicone Sealant: To produce a weatherproof seal.
- Door Lock and Handle: If not currently consisted of with the panel.
Step-by-Step Guide to Fitting UPVC Door Panels
Fitting UPVC door panels can be a manageable DIY task. Follow these steps for an effective installation:
Step 1: Measure the Door Frame
- Step the height and width of the door frame to ensure that the UPVC panel is the correct size.
- If you are changing an old door, remove it and thoroughly measure the space readily available.
Step 2: Prepare the Panel
- Check the UPVC door panel for any flaws.
- If the panel needs to be lowered, utilize a hacksaw or panel cutter to attain the correct dimensions.
Step 3: Pre-fit the Panel
- Place the UPVC door panel into the frame to see how it fits.
- Utilize the level to guarantee it is straight and adjust as essential.
Step 4: Fix the Panel in Place
- Secure the panel using screws and mendings.
- Start from the top and work your method to avoid any movement.
Step 5: Install Lock and Handle
- Follow the producer's instructions to install the lock and manage.
- Make sure the locking mechanism aligns properly with the strike plate.
Step 6: Seal the Edges
- Utilize a silicone sealant around the edges of the panel to produce a waterproof barrier.
- Use the sealant weapon to apply a smooth line and clean any excess with a fabric.
Step 7: Final Checking
- Evaluate the door to ensure it opens and closes smoothly.
- Inspect the lock system to confirm it functions effectively.
Step 8: Clean Up
- Eliminate any tools and remaining materials.
- Tidy the door panel with a moderate cleaning agent to eliminate fingerprints or dust.
Frequently Asked Question About UPVC Door Panel Fitting
1. Can I fit a UPVC door panel myself?
Yes, if you have basic DIY skills and the essential tools, you can fit a UPVC door panel yourself. However, guarantee you follow the guidelines thoroughly for best outcomes.
2. What if my door frame is uneven?
If your door frame is not level, you may require to use shims to adjust the panel's height. Constantly examine the level during installation.
3. Do I require an expert tool to cut UPVC?
No specialized tools are needed; a hacksaw or a panel cutter will work fine. Guarantee you cut slowly and steadily for a straight edge.
4. How do I tidy my UPVC door panel?
You can utilize warm soapy water and a soft fabric for a quick tidy. For harder discolorations, a moderate home cleaner can be reliable.
5. How often do I need to preserve my UPVC door?
Usually, UPVC doors require minimal maintenance. It's recommended to check hinges and locks regularly and clean the surface as needed.
